K-Pop Icon PSY To Join UNTOLD Dubai 2024 Lineup
Updated on 23 January 2024

Dubai-ites get ready to dance 'Gangnam Style' as the South Korean sensation and K-pop idol PSY is all set to perform at the UNTOLD Dubai festival. Known for his international hits like 'That That', 'Gangnam Style', 'New Face', and more, PSY will bring his infectious energy and chart-topping tracks to the UNTOLD Dubai stage, captivating audiences in a performance like no other.

PSY garnered global attention in 2012 with the release of 'Gangnam Style', with the iconic music video becoming the first to surpass one billion views on YouTube. With a career of over two decades, PSY has continued to captivate audiences with his unique style and electrifying performances. 
 
PSY also performed at the February 2013 inauguration of former South Korean President Park Geun-Hye, and on 12 April, his new single, 'Gentleman' became another international hit. It reached number five on the Billboard Hot 100 and number one on Billboard’s Korea K-Pop Hot 100. The 'Gentleman' music video set a new YouTube record with 38 million views in one day.

And now, PSY is all set to take Dubai by storm alongside an an already impressive line-up including Ellie Goulding, G-Eazy, Major Lazer, Armin Van Buuren, Bebe Rexha, Don Diablo, Paul Kalkbrenner, Timmy Trumpet, Hardwell, and more.

The UNTOLD music festival is being held from 15 to 18 February and promises an unforgettable four-day musical extravaganza that transcends genres. With over 100 artists descending on Expo City, the festival caters to diverse musical tastes, featuring sensational DJs, dynamic hip-hop beats, mind-blowing alternative rock, and much more.
